On the 26th March 2011, a group of ten intrepid (idiotic), fitness fanatics (fat 20/30 somethings) are attempting to ride from the famous Weston Eye in sunny Weston Super Mare to the smaller and less well known Millennium Eye in the village of London in aid of Weston Hospice Care. What's more these ten heroes (idiots) are going to attempt it in a single day!
